Question:

 

My wife wants to apply for khula as I have a love affair with another lady ‘ can she go for it as due to this affair she is being neglected as I am unable to give her time and attention but giving money to run bread and butter.

 

 

In the name of Allah, the Most Gracious, the Most Merciful

 

 

Answer:

 

Firstly I would like to explain the process of Khul’a: Allah has stated in the Quran: And if you fear that they would not maintain the limits of Allah (i.e. marriage) then there is no sin upon them both in what she (the wife) gives up to secure her release. (Surah Al-Baqarah Verse 229)

 

In light of the above-mentioned verse, if the couple cannot maintain their marriage and the husband refuses to issue the wife a talaq, it will be permissible for the wife to give some money or wealth to the husband, which is agreed upon by both husband and wife, in exchange of releasing herself from his wedlock.

 

It is important to note that it is necessary for the husband to agree to the khula for it to be valid.

 

If the husband agrees to the Khula, the amount will be compulsory for the wife to pay to the husband and a talaq al-ba’in (divorce absolute) will take place. After completing the iddah (waiting period) the wife will be permitted to marry elsewhere if she wishes to.[1]

 

Secondly, it needs to be mentioned that any love affair outside wedlock is haram and therefore needs to be abandoned immediately.

 

In regards to your situation, if either you or your wife fears that you will not be able to uphold each other’s rights which have been given by the shariah, the wife may exercise her right to ask for khula.
